shopping_freak_3-1024x683.jpgOne of the primary reasons for conducting an LLC entity search is to ensure compliance with state regulations. Each state has its own set of rules governing the formation and operation of LLCs. These rules often include requirements for unique enterprise names, which must be distinguishable from existing entities. By using an LLC entity search directory, entrepreneurs can verify that their desired enterprise name is not already in use, thus avoiding potential legal complications down the road. This step is particularly important because many states require companies to operate under a name that is not deceptively similar to another registered entity.

The Florida Entity Search is an online platform that allows users to search for registered entities by name, document number, or officer name. This service is available to the public business records search at no cost, making it an highly valuable tool for anyone interested in the commercial landscape of Florida. The search results provide a range of details, including the entity's status (active, inactive, or dissolved), date of registration, principal address, and names of the officers and directors.

Additionally, LLC entity search resources often provide details about the members or managers of an LLC. This openness is important for conducting due diligence, particularly for investors and partners who want to understand the background and experience of the individuals involved in the enterprise. By accessing this details, entrepreneurs can make informed decisions about potential collaborations, partnerships, or acquisitions.
